Throwback Thanksgiving Thursday

A couple weeks ago I was going through some of my old draft posts and realized I never shared my "Thanksgiving Recap" from last year! It sure was a special one!

The Wednesday day before we headed out of town, Robbie took me to dinner at one of our favorite restaurants in Charleston, Fleet Landing, which was also where we had our first date. While waiting for our table, we got drinks and watched the sunset over the harbor and he got down on one knee and asked me to marry him!! It was the best Thanksgiving Eve ever! :)


Our parents came and met up with us for dinner to celebrate!

Then Thursday morning we headed to Beaufort to celebrate "Thanksgiving in the street" with Robbie's family. We wanted to keep our engagement to our close friends and family at first while we shared with everyone so this was my Instagram from last year, carefully hiding the new shiny ring on my finger! ;)
 

We finally shared with our friends on social media and enjoyed this gorgeous sunset out on the porch in front of the fire.

Next up was Thanksgiving round two with my family in Hilton Head!

We continued the celebrations and my mom took some engagement photos out on the beach since it was such a gorgeous day!


It was such a blessing to share such a special time with our family and made me more aware of all of the things I was thankful for then, and still am thankful for today!
